About
Loyola Living Center is an immersive landscape designed to support wellness, connection, and daily engagement with nature. Created for a senior living community in Austin, the project blends native planting communities, accessible outdoor spaces, and regenerative stormwater infrastructure into a cohesive landscape experience.
At the heart of the design are a series of wetland-inspired rain gardens that capture, filter, and slow stormwater before it leaves the site. Integrated biofiltration systems, native aquatic and upland plant communities, and elevated boardwalks transform this infrastructure into an amenity—allowing residents to experience seasonal change, wildlife habitat, and the rhythms of water throughout the year.
Accessible walking loops, gathering spaces, pollinator gardens, and shaded seating areas encourage exploration and social connection while supporting long-term ecological resilience. The planting palette emphasizes native and well-adapted species that provide habitat, reduce water consumption, and create year-round texture, color, and shade.
Rather than separating sustainability from daily life, Loyola Living Center weaves environmental stewardship into the resident experience, creating a landscape that is restorative, resilient, and deeply connected to the Central Texas landscape.
